FEATURE: Mailing list mode default disabled (#11091)

Mailing list mode can generate significant email volume, especially on sites with a large user base. Disable mailing list mode via site settings by default so sites don't experience an unexpectedly large cost from outgoing email.
This commit is contained in:
Joshua Rosenfeld
2021-03-04 15:24:37 -05:00
committed by GitHub
parent 8d96713aa0
commit 75dc01627d
5 changed files with 6 additions and 1 deletions

View File

@ -1682,6 +1682,7 @@ describe User do
SiteSetting.default_email_digest_frequency = 1440 # daily
SiteSetting.default_email_level = UserOption.email_level_types[:never]
SiteSetting.default_email_messages_level = UserOption.email_level_types[:never]
SiteSetting.disable_mailing_list_mode = false
SiteSetting.default_email_mailing_list_mode = true
SiteSetting.default_other_new_topic_duration_minutes = -1 # not viewed